What Aceclofenac Paracetamol Suspension ?
Aceclofenac Paracetamol Suspension is a medication that combines two active ingredients: Aceclofenac and Paracetamol.
- Aceclofenac: This is a nonsteroidal anti-inflammatory drug (NSAID) that is used to relieve pain and reduce inflammation. It works by inhibiting the production of certain chemicals in the body that cause pain and inflammation.
- Paracetamol (also known as acetaminophen): This is a commonly used analgesic (pain reliever) and antipyretic (fever reducer). It works by blocking the production of prostaglandins, which are chemicals in the body that cause pain and fever.
Aceclofenac Paracetamol Suspension Uses
- Pain Relief: It is used to alleviate mild to moderate pain, such as headache, dental pain, menstrual cramps, and musculoskeletal pain.
- Inflammation: It is used to reduce inflammation associated with conditions like osteoarthritis, rheumatoid arthritis, and ankylosing spondylitis.
- Fever: Paracetamol component helps in reducing fever.
- Post-operative Pain: It may be prescribed after surgical procedures to manage pain and inflammation.
- Muscle Pain: It can be used for conditions like muscle sprains and strains.
- Dental Pain: It can be used for relieving dental pain.
- Menstrual Pain: It may be prescribed to alleviate pain associated with menstruation.
Aceclofenac Paracetamol Suspension – Mechanism of Action and Pharmacology
- Aceclofenac:
- Mechanism of Action: Aceclofenac is a nonsteroidal anti-inflammatory drug (NSAID). It works by inhibiting the activity of an enzyme called cyclooxygenase (COX). COX is involved in the production of substances in the body known as prostaglandins. Prostaglandins play a role in the inflammatory response, causing pain, swelling, and fever. By inhibiting COX, aceclofenac reduces the production of prostaglandins, thereby alleviating pain and inflammation.
- Pharmacology: Aceclofenac is rapidly absorbed after oral administration. It is then metabolized in the liver to its active form, diclofenac. Diclofenac is the compound responsible for the anti-inflammatory effects of aceclofenac.
- Paracetamol (Acetaminophen):
- Mechanism of Action: The exact mechanism of action of paracetamol is not fully understood. It is believed to work by inhibiting an enzyme called cyclooxygenase (COX), but it has a greater affinity for the COX enzyme in the central nervous system (brain and spinal cord) compared to the peripheral tissues. This makes paracetamol more effective in reducing pain and fever than in reducing inflammation.
- Pharmacology: Paracetamol is rapidly absorbed from the gastrointestinal tract and distributed throughout the body. It undergoes metabolism in the liver, and the majority of it is excreted in the urine as inactive metabolites.
Aceclofenac Paracetamol Suspension – Side Effect
- Nausea and Upset Stomach: Some people may experience stomach discomfort, nausea, or indigestion after taking this medication.
- Headache: Headaches can occur as a side effect of this medication.
- Dizziness: Some individuals may feel dizzy or lightheaded after taking Aceclofenac Paracetamol suspension.
- Allergic Reactions: While uncommon, some people may be allergic to one or more of the ingredients in the suspension, which can lead to symptoms such as rash, itching, swelling, severe dizziness, or difficulty breathing.
